City Council to Act on Resolution Changing Bank Signatories for Gunter Accounts

The Gunter City Council will discuss and act upon a resolution to remove former Mayor Pro Tem Alan Richins and Mayor Karen Souther as bank signatories. The measure designates four officials with transactional, administrative, and inquiry powers for city accounts at Simmons Bank.

Resolution Overview

The Gunter City Council will discuss, consider, and act upon a resolution during its Sept. 3, 2026 meeting.

The agenda item addresses updates to authorized signatories for municipal banking operations.

Changes to Bank Signatories

The proposed measure would remove former Mayor Pro Tem Alan Richins and Mayor Karen Souther as signatories for city accounts held at Simmons Bank.

Council members will evaluate the removal as part of the agenda item.

Authorized Powers and Officials

The resolution designates Mayor Pro Tem Wade Burtsfield, Alderman William Hemby, City Manager Hayden Brodowsky, and City Secretary Detra Gaines for the accounts.

These officials would receive transactional and disbursement powers, administrative and account management powers, and information and inquiry powers.
